Technical Problem

When cleaning existing chain plate turning machines, manual hand-held water hose rinsing is inconvenient and not thorough enough, and cannot effectively remove materials adhering to the surface of the equipment.

Method used

The system employs a water distribution pipe and high-pressure water pump system. By driving the water distribution pipe to move back and forth, high-pressure water is sprayed from the nozzles to thoroughly wash the chain plate. The tilting angle and depth are adjusted by a hydraulic cylinder.

Benefits of technology

It achieves a thorough cleaning of the chain plate surface, preventing the adhesion of materials such as fertilizer, and improving cleaning efficiency and effectiveness.

TECHNICAL FIELD

[0001] The utility model belongs to the technical field of turner, specifically relates to a chain plate type turner preventing fertilizer from adhering. BACKGROUND

[0002] When fermenting various organic wastes in the fermentation tank, for example, livestock and poultry manure, sludge garbage, filter mud of sugar factory, cake and sawdust of straw, if only static composting, often due to insufficient support and anaerobic fermentation, a large amount of hydrogen sulfide and other odors will be produced, and there is an explosion risk, therefore, when fermenting various organic wastes in the fermentation tank, the organic wastes need to be continuously turned over.

[0003] The chain plate turner has the advantages of complete turning and long moving distance and is widely used, and in the process of long-term use of the chain plate turner, too much impurities are easily accumulated on the components of the chain plate turner, thereby affecting the subsequent use work, and the cleaning work needs to be regularly carried out, at present, the cleaning work is mostly manually holding a water pipe to flush, on the one hand, the flushing is inconvenient, on the other hand, the flushing is not comprehensive enough, and the effective flushing cannot guarantee that the surface of the equipment is clean of adhered materials. DETAILED DESCRIPTION

[0021] The utility model will be further explained in connection with the drawings and specific embodiment:

[0022] As Figs. 1-3 The utility model provides a chain plate type turner that prevents fertilizer from adhering and sticking, including frame trolley 1, the frame trolley 1 is the frame structure surrounded by multiple rods, multiple wheels 16 are arranged below the frame trolley 1, and then the frame trolley 1 can be conveniently moved.

[0023] Two sides in the frame trolley 1 are provided with mounting plate 2, transmission wheel 3 is penetrated through the bearing between two mounting plate 2, and the surface of transmission wheel 3 is connected with chain plate 4 in transmission, turns over and throws by the transmission of transmission wheel 3 and chain plate 4, two first hydraulic cylinders 5 and two second hydraulic cylinders 6 are fixedly arranged on the top of frame trolley 1, the telescopic end of two first hydraulic cylinders 5 is respectively hingedly connected with the end of corresponding mounting plate 2, and the telescopic end of two second hydraulic cylinders 6 is respectively hingedly connected with the middle of corresponding mounting plate 2, mounting plate 2 is hoisted and fixed by first hydraulic cylinder 5 and second hydraulic cylinder 6, and the inclination angle of two mounting plate 2 is adjusted by the telescopic cooperation of first hydraulic cylinder 5 and second hydraulic cylinder 6, so as to adjust the height of one end of mounting plate 2 that is inclined to the lower side, and the adjustment of turn over angle and turn over depth is realized.

[0024] One end of frame trolley 1 is provided with a driving mechanism for driving transmission wheel 3 to rotate, the driving mechanism includes motor 12 fixedly arranged on frame trolley 1, the motor 12 is provided with two, the output end of motor 12 is fixedly connected with first sprocket 13, and motor 12 drives corresponding first sprocket 13 to rotate, one end of transmission wheel 3 is fixedly connected with second sprocket 14 through the penetration of mounting plate 2, and two second sprockets 14 are located at the two ends of the transmission wheel 3, the first sprocket 13 and the second sprocket 14 are connected in chain transmission through chain 15, so as to drive transmission wheel 3 to rotate through motor 12, realize chain transmission and turn over.

[0025] The rack trolley 1 is provided with two screw rods 7 above the rack trolley 1, the screw rods 7 are provided with power devices 8 at the ends of the screw rods 7, the power devices 8 are used for driving the screw rods 7 to rotate, the power devices 8 are motors, the rack trolley 1 is provided with two sliding blocks 9 above the rack trolley 1, the two sliding blocks 9 are respectively threadedly connected with the corresponding screw rods 7, when the screw rods 7 rotate, the sliding blocks 9 are driven to move, when the sliding blocks 9 reach the limit of the stroke, the power devices 8 drive the screw rods 7 to reverse, the sliding blocks 9 move reversely, the two sliding blocks 9 are fixedly provided with a water distribution pipe 10 between the two sliding blocks 9, the water distribution pipe 10 is provided with a water pump 11, a hose (not shown in the figure) is connected to the water inlet end of the water pump 11, the hose is connected with a water source, the water pump 11 pressurizes and delivers water into the water distribution pipe 10, a plurality of spray heads are arranged on the lower side of the water distribution pipe 10, the plurality of spray heads are located above the chain plates 4, in the reciprocating movement of the water distribution pipe 10 along with the sliding blocks 9, the water sprayed by the spray heads is used for washing the chain plates 4.

[0026] In use, the motor 12 is used for driving the transmission wheel 3 to rotate, the chain plates 4 are driven to rotate, and then the turning and throwing are realized, meanwhile, in the process, the first hydraulic cylinder 5 and the second hydraulic cylinder 6 are used for adjusting the inclination angles of the two mounting plates 2, and then the turning and throwing angles and the turning and throwing depths of the chain plates 4 are adjusted, along with the continuous movement of the rack trolley 1, the turning and throwing work is completed.

[0027] Subsequently, the first hydraulic cylinder 5 and the second hydraulic cylinder 6 are used for adjusting the inclination angles of the two mounting plates 2, so that the chain plates 4 are close to the horizontal state, meanwhile, the water pump 11, the motor 12 and the power device 8 are started, the water pump 11 delivers high-pressure water into the water distribution pipe 10, and the water is sprayed out through the plurality of spray heads to wash the chain plates 4, the power device 8 is used for driving the water distribution pipe 10 to reciprocate, so that the chain plates 4 are fully and effectively washed, and the surface of the chain plates 4 is prevented from being adhered with the fertilizer.

[0028] It should be noted that, according to the actual washing needs, the surface of the chain plates 4 can be washed without starting the power device 8 or without adjusting the inclination angles of the chain plates 4 to be close to the horizontal state.

[0029] When the chain plates 4 are washed, the rack trolley 1 can be moved to the corresponding position in advance, and then the washing is performed, so that the splashing of the washing water does not affect the material to be turned and thrown.
